I have read and re-read threads on converting from a dvd to an avi, but it appears to be of no use to me. I have purchased SuperTroopers and wanted to rip it and convert to an avi to store on a portable hd to take with me. When I use dvddecrypt to rip it off,I select Region 1, which I am and rip it. But when I try to load the files into any conversion program the preview shows a message that the dvd isn't coded for my region, then shows the FBI warning in Spanish of all things. What am I doing wrong? And is there an easy all in one program that will rip it correctly and encode to avi or mp4 or something of the sort?

Hello and welcome to the forum,

What am I doing wrong?

You should be using DVD Decrypter in IFO Mode (up at the top, Mode->IFO), instead of the default File Mode. That way you should get just the movie, without the other garbage.

in DVDDec you can look under tools->drive->regional code for information on what region your drive is set up as. You can either change it or disable it from there, that might be what you're looking for. Ensure the drive is set either to the region of the disc, or the checking is disabled.
